CVE-2005-1588

SQL injection vulnerability in index.php for Quick.cart 0.3.0 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the iCategory parameter. NOTE: the vendor has privately disputed this issue, saying that Quick.cart does not even use SQL and therefore can not be vulnerable to SQL injection
